Prepared for the incoming director. This summary assesses the proposed shift of monthly subscribers on the Fenlight platform to annual billing. Approximately 62% of revenue is currently monthly. Modelling indicates a one-time cash inflow improvement of roughly 18% in the transition quarter, with deferred-revenue treatment reviewed by the audit team. Discount incentives of up to two months are proposed to ease conversion. Churn sensitivity remains the principal risk. The confidential note below outlines the broader business rationale.

board note of fawef-fafof: Praixox Works is in early talks to buy Ralysox Logistics for about $310.0 million. The Oliath launch date is January 28, and nothing goes to the press before then. Legal wants the Belwynix Freight term sheet signed before March 17.

**Checklist: Autocomplete index warm-up**

Heads up, new folks: the Lanternfish autocomplete index is sluggish right after deploy until the shard caches warm. Run the warm-up script against the staging replica, then confirm p99 suggest latency drops under 120ms before flipping traffic. If it stays slow, ping the search channel. Log the deployed build right below this line.

trace token, fafog-kageg: htk4_98e6

Subject: Snapshot cut-over complete for Lintwheel UI

Hi on-call,

We finished migrating Lintwheel's component snapshot tests to the new renderer tonight. All 412 snapshots regenerated cleanly; three flaky date-pickers were quarantined and ticketed. Watch for diff noise in the first nightly run and page Priya's team if failures exceed five. The active settings for the snapshot service are as follows.

settings of kawif-tawig:
[pelok]
port = 5432
region = lower-3
host = pelok.crelvocorp.example
team = fraox
timeout_ms = 750
retries = 7

# REPLICA_LAG_ALARM_THRESHOLD_MS
#
# If you're new to the Quillbrook data platform: this constant sets
# the point at which our read-replica lag alarm fires. We chose 4500ms
# after the Marloft incident, where stale reads caused duplicate
# ledger entries. Do not lower it without checking the replay buffer
# sizing doc, and do not raise it without sign-off from the storage
# rotation. Every change here must reference the build that shipped it.
# The token below identifies that build.

pipeline stamp: htk9_6ce9d33c5